http://shamrockaffiliations.ws/Stearin.php sherborn senior center網頁Palm stearic acid (or stearin) is generally used as a wax hardener which helps pillar or freestanding candles hold their shape in warmer climates. It also increases wax opacity (whiteness) and assists with mold release. The amount of stearic acid you use will depend on the type of wax and desired results. Generally, 1 part stearic acid to 20 parts wax is recommended as a starting point.
